Synchrony basically did a CLI reallocation (100K)

After my TJX CLI increase yesterday along with the closing of my Bananna Republic ($500) store card, I vowed to be finish requesting anything from Synchrony.  Then along came CreditMagic7 spreading his/her magic around.  Well I got a dose of it.  I was already at $99,500 with Synchrony and had heard previously that 100k is pretty much the exposure limit.  My cards were as follows: ebates visa @20k, walmart mastercard @20k, paypal mastercard @20k, TJX mastercard @20k, BP Visa @10k, Old Navy Visa @10k and BP store card @2500.  I called tonight (got the same agent from last night) to ask for a CLI (I know I know) on my Old Navy Visa 7k to 10k.  Made sure I complimented the agent for helping me last night.  She took my information and came back and said in order to approve your request you will have to reduce the limit on one of your other Synchrony cards.  Here's where CreditMagic7 comes into the picture.  He/she had closed one of their Synchrony accounts with the desire to get a better/higher limit card in the future.  I had contemplated closing my BP store card at some point in the future to hopefully increase the Old Navy Visa to 10k.  When the agent suggested reducing a limit on one of my cards, I immediately asked to close the BP store card and move the limit over to the Old Navy Visa.  She said I would have to go through customer service to close the card.  She gave me a reference number to call credit solutions back after I got finished with customer service.  She then got customer service on the phone and explained that I wanted to close the BP store card and then she disconnected.  Once customer service closed the account, I called credit solutions back hoping to get the same agent, but I didnt.  The new agent with customer service took the reference number and went through the credit limit increase process again.  I was worried, but she came back and said congrats your new limit on your Old Navy Visa is 10k.  That was basically a reallocation in a round about way.

 

ebates visa $20,000

paypayl mastercard $20,000

walmart mastercard $20,000

TJX mastercard $20,000

BP visa $10,000

Old navy visa $10,000

 

It does appear, for me anyway, that Synchrony's limit is 100k and I'm loving every bit of it.Heart
